クラス
java.security.KeyStoreExceptionの使用
KeyStoreExceptionを使用するパッケージ
パッケージ
説明
セキュリティ・フレームワークのクラスとインタフェースを提供します。
証明書、証明書失効リスト(CRL)、証明書パスを解析および管理するためのクラスとインタフェースを提供します。
セキュア・ソケット・パッケージのクラスを提供します。
-
java.securityでのKeyStoreExceptionの使用
KeyStoreExceptionを投げるjava.securityのメソッド修飾子と型メソッド説明final Enumeration<String> KeyStore.aliases()このキーストアのすべての別名を一覧表示します。final booleanKeyStore.containsAlias(String alias) このキーストアに、指定された別名が存在するかどうかを判定します。final voidKeyStore.deleteEntry(String alias) このキーストアから、指定された別名によって識別されるエントリを削除します。abstract voidKeyStoreSpi.engineDeleteEntry(String alias) このキーストアから、指定された別名によって識別されるエントリを削除します。KeyStoreSpi.engineGetEntry(String alias, KeyStore.ProtectionParameter protParam) 指定された保護パラメータを使用して、指定された別名に対するKeyStore.Entryを取得します。abstract voidKeyStoreSpi.engineSetCertificateEntry(String alias, Certificate cert) 指定された別名に、指定された証明書を割り当てます。voidKeyStoreSpi.engineSetEntry(String alias, KeyStore.Entry entry, KeyStore.ProtectionParameter protParam) KeyStore.Entryを指定された別名で保存します。abstract voidKeyStoreSpi.engineSetKeyEntry(String alias, byte[] key, Certificate[] chain) 指定された別名に、すでに保護されている指定のキーを割り当てます。abstract voidKeyStoreSpi.engineSetKeyEntry(String alias, Key key, char[] password, Certificate[] chain) 指定された別名に指定されたキーを割り当て、指定されたパスワードでそのキーを保護します。final booleanKeyStore.entryInstanceOf(String alias, Class<? extends KeyStore.Entry> entryClass) 指定されたaliasのキーストアEntryが、指定されたentryClassのインスタンスまたはサブクラスであるかどうかを判定します。final Set<KeyStore.Entry.Attribute> KeyStore.getAttributes(String alias) 指定された別名に関連付けられた属性を取得します。final CertificateKeyStore.getCertificate(String alias) 指定された別名に関連した証明書を返します。final StringKeyStore.getCertificateAlias(Certificate cert) 指定された証明書と一致する証明書がある最初のキーストア・エントリの別名を返します。final Certificate[]KeyStore.getCertificateChain(String alias) 指定された別名に関連付けられている証明書チェーンを返します。final DateKeyStore.getCreationDate(String alias) 指定された別名によって識別されるエントリの作成日を返します。final KeyStore.EntryKeyStore.getEntry(String alias, KeyStore.ProtectionParameter protParam) 指定された保護パラメータを使用して、指定された別名に対するキーストアEntryを取得します。static final KeyStoreKeyStore.getInstance(File file, char[] password) 適切なキーストア・タイプのロードされたキーストア・オブジェクトを返します。static final KeyStoreKeyStore.getInstance(File file, KeyStore.LoadStoreParameter param) 適切なキーストア・タイプのロードされたキーストア・オブジェクトを返します。static KeyStoreKeyStore.getInstance(String type) 指定されたタイプのKeyStoreオブジェクトを返します。static KeyStoreKeyStore.getInstance(String type, String provider) 指定されたタイプのKeyStoreオブジェクトを返します。static KeyStoreKeyStore.getInstance(String type, Provider provider) 指定されたタイプのKeyStoreオブジェクトを返します。final Key指定されたパスワードを使って、指定された別名に関連したキーを復元し、そのキーを返します。abstract KeyStoreKeyStore.Builder.getKeyStore()このオブジェクトによって記述されたKeyStoreを返します。abstract KeyStore.ProtectionParameterKeyStore.Builder.getProtectionParameter(String alias) 指定された別名でEntryを取得するために使用する必要があるProtectionParameterを返します。final booleanKeyStore.isCertificateEntry(String alias) 指定された別名で識別されるエントリがsetCertificateEntryへのコールによって作成されたか、TrustedCertificateEntryを使用してsetEntryへのコールによって作成された場合は、trueを返します。final booleanKeyStore.isKeyEntry(String alias) 指定された別名で識別されるエントリがsetKeyEntryへのコールによって作成されたか、PrivateKeyEntryまたはSecretKeyEntryを使用してsetEntryへのコールによって作成された場合は、trueを返します。final voidKeyStore.setCertificateEntry(String alias, Certificate cert) 指定された別名に、指定された信頼できる証明書を割り当てます。final voidKeyStore.setEntry(String alias, KeyStore.Entry entry, KeyStore.ProtectionParameter protParam) キーストアEntryを指定された別名で保存します。final voidKeyStore.setKeyEntry(String alias, byte[] key, Certificate[] chain) 指定された別名に、すでに保護されている指定のキーを割り当てます。final voidKeyStore.setKeyEntry(String alias, Key key, char[] password, Certificate[] chain) 指定された別名に指定されたキーを割り当て、指定されたパスワードでそのキーを保護します。final intKeyStore.size()このキーストアのエントリ数を取得します。final voidKeyStore.store(OutputStream stream, char[] password) 指定された出力ストリームにこのキーストアを格納し、指定されたパスワードでその整合性を保護します。final voidKeyStore.store(KeyStore.LoadStoreParameter param) 指定されたLoadStoreParameterを使用してこのキーストアを格納します。 -
java.security.certでのKeyStoreExceptionの使用
KeyStoreExceptionをスローするjava.security.certのコンストラクタ修飾子コンストラクタ説明PKIXBuilderParameters(KeyStore keystore, CertSelector targetConstraints) もっとも信頼できるCAのセットを、指定したKeyStoreに含まれる信頼できる証明書エントリから生成する、PKIXBuilderParametersのインスタンスを作成します。PKIXParameters(KeyStore keystore) もっとも信頼できるCAのセットを、指定したKeyStoreに含まれる信頼できる証明書エントリから生成する、PKIXParametersのインスタンスを作成します。 -
javax.net.sslでのKeyStoreExceptionの使用
KeyStoreExceptionを投げるjavax.net.sslのメソッド修飾子と型メソッド説明protected abstract voidKeyManagerFactorySpi.engineInit(KeyStore ks, char[] password) キー・データのソースを使用して、このファクトリを初期化します。protected abstract voidTrustManagerFactorySpi.engineInit(KeyStore ks) 証明書発行局と関連する信頼データのソースを使用して、このファクトリを初期化します。final voidキー・データのソースを使用して、このファクトリを初期化します。final void証明書発行局と関連する信頼データのソースを使用して、このファクトリを初期化します。